Catatan: Kami ingin secepatnya menyediakan konten bantuan terbaru dalam bahasa Anda. Halaman ini diterjemahkan menggunakan mesin dan mungkin terdapat kesalahan tata bahasa atau masalah keakuratan. Kami bertujuan menyediakan konten yang bermanfaat untuk Anda. Dapatkah Anda memberi tahu kami apakah informasi ini bermanfaat untuk Anda di bagian bawah halaman ini? Berikut artikel dalam bahasa Inggris untuk referensi.
Dalam artikel ini
Pengenalan ke ruang lingkup input
Jika Anda ingin meningkatkan pengenalan input teks non-keyboard di kontrol, seperti teks yang dimasukkan ke dalam kotak teks dengan pena tablet, Anda bisa menentukan lingkup input untuk kontrol. Lingkup input memungkinkan Anda untuk menentukan tipe input pengguna yang ditujukan untuk kontrol. Misalnya, jika Anda menggunakan IS_URL lingkup input untuk kotak teks, spasi yang dimasukkan di antara kata diabaikan.
Lingkup input bisa diatur untuk tipe kontrol berikut ini:
-
Kotak teks
-
Kotak teks kaya
-
Pemilih tanggal
-
Daftar berpoin
-
Daftar bernomor
-
Daftar biasa
-
Kotak kombo
-
Kotak daftar beberapa pilihan
Untuk menentukan lingkup input, klik ganda kontrol. Dalam kotak dialog Properti kontrol , klik tab tingkat lanjut , dan kemudian klik Lingkup Input.
Tipe input lingkup
Ada tiga tipe input lingkup:
Semua tipe input lingkup bisa dikonfigurasi untuk membatasi input untuk mencocokkan hanya ditentukan input lingkup pola atau hanya bias input pola. Secara default, input lingkupnya terbatas untuk mencocokkan hanya pola lingkup input. Untuk memperbolehkan input cocok, tetapi masih bias mendekati lingkup input, pilih kotak centang mengenali cocok input dalam kotak dialog Lingkup Input .
Catatan:
-
Lingkup input berlaku hanya untuk mengontrol di mana yang diatur, bukan bidang yang kontrol terikat.
-
Fitur ruang lingkup input tidak berfungsi dengan recognizers bahasa Asia Timur.
Bagian berikut menjelaskan setiap tipe input lingkup.
Standar
Untuk mengatur lingkup input standar, klik standar dalam kotak dialog Input lingkup , dan lalu klik Pengaturan di daftar lingkup Input . Tabel berikut menjelaskan pola yang ditetapkan untuk setiap lingkup input standar dan menyediakan contoh jenis input yang ditujukan untuk menerapkan.
Lingkup input |
Deskripsi |
IS_DEFAULT |
Pengenalan standar bias. Diperlakukan sebagai default dan memanfaatkan kosakata yang berbeda default (Kosakata). |
IS_URL |
URL, File, dan FTP format. Contoh:
|
IS_FILE_FULLFILEPATH |
Karakter yang digunakan dalam menggambarkan jalur file. Menyertakan kondisi berikut:
Contoh:
|
IS_FILE_FILENAME |
Karakter yang digunakan dalam menggambarkan nama file. Menyertakan kondisi berikut:
Contoh:
|
IS_EMAIL_USERNAME |
Nama pengguna email. Contoh:
|
IS_EMAIL_SMTPEMAILADDRESS |
Alamat email SMTP selesai. Misalnya, someone@example.com. |
IS_LOGINNAME |
Nama masuk dan domain. Menyertakan kondisi berikut:
Contoh:
|
IS_PERSONALNAME_FULLNAME |
Kombinasi nama depan, tengah, dan terakhir.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_PERSONALNAME_PREFIX |
Predikat atau judul sebelum nama.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_PERSONALNAME_GIVENNAME |
Nama depan atau inisial.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_PERSONALNAME_MIDDLENAME |
Nama atau inisial. Contoh:
|
IS_PERSONALNAME_SURNAME |
Nama belakang.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_PERSONALNAME_SUFFIX |
Nama Sufiks, tindakan, dan angka Romawi. Sebagai contoh, Jr. |
IS_ADDRESS_FULLPOSTALADDRESS |
Alamat lengkap, termasuk angka.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_ADDRESS_POSTALCODE |
Kode pos alfanumerik (untuk dukungan internasional).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_ADDRESS_STREET |
Nomor rumah, jalan, apartemen nama dan nomor, dan pos kotak saja. Sebagai contoh, 123 utama jalan. |
IS_ADDRESS_STATEORPROVINCE |
Nama lengkap atau singkatan dari negara bagian atau provinsi.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_ADDRESS_CITY |
Nama atau singkatan dari kota.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_ADDRESS_COUNTRYNAME |
Nama negara.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_ADDRESS_COUNTRYSHORTNAME |
Singkatan untuk negara.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_CURRENCY_AMOUNTANDSYMBOL |
Simbol mata uang dan angka.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_CURRENCY_AMOUNT |
Nilai numerik untuk mata uang, termasuk simbol mata uang. Sebagai contoh, 2,100.25. |
IS_DATE_FULLDATE |
Tanggal lengkap, dalam berbagai format.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_DATE_MONTH |
Representasi numerik bulan, dibatasi hingga 1-12. Contoh:
|
IS_DATE_DAY |
Representasi numerik hari, dibatasi hingga 1-31. Contoh:
|
IS_DATE_YEAR |
Representasi numerik tahun. Contoh:
|
IS_DATE_MONTHNAME |
Representasi karakter bulan.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_DATE_DAYNAME |
Representasi karakter hari.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_DIGITS |
Bilangan bulat positif. String digit yang dibuat dari 0-9 yang diperbolehkan. |
IS_NUMBER |
Angka, termasuk koma, tanda negatif, dan desimal. Untuk lokasi Amerika Serikat, termasuk kondisi berikut:
|
IS_ONECHAR |
Karakter ANSI tunggal, codepage 1252. Untuk lokasi Amerika Serikat, ini menyertakan karakter berikut: ABCDEFGHIJKLMNOPQRSTUVWXYZabcdEfghijklmnopqrstuvwxyz0123456789!\"#$% &' () * +,-. /:; <> =? @[\] ^ _'{|} ~ |
IS_TELEPHONE_FULLTELEPHONENUMBER |
Nomor telepon. Tidak mendukung angka dengan huruf.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_TELEPHONE_COUNTRYCODE |
Kode negara telepon.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_TELEPHONE_AREACODE |
Kode area telepon.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_TELEPHONE_LOCALNUMBER |
Nomor telepon, termasuk negara atau kode area.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_TIME_FULLTIME |
Jam, menit, detik, dan waktu alfabet singkatan. Bahasa Inggris Amerika Serikat menggunakan jam 12 jam. Awalan nol opsional untuk jam tetapi diperlukan untuk menit dan detik. Jam dibatasi ke 0-24; menit dan detik dibatasi hingga 0 59. Contoh, diformat untuk bahasa Inggris (Amerika Serikat):
|
IS_TIME_HOUR |
Representasi numerik jam. Dibatasi 0 24. |
IS_TIME_MINORSEC |
Representasi numerik menit atau detik. Dibatasi hingga 0 59. |
Daftar frasa
Mengatur lingkup input sebagai Daftar frasa memungkinkan Anda menentukan daftar kata atau frasa untuk membatasi atau bias input yang dimasukkan ke kontrol. Misalnya, Anda bisa membuat daftar frasa yang bernama "Utama warna" untuk kotak teks dan lalu Atur daftar untuk "merah", "Kuning" dan "biru". Dalam skenario ini, jika pengguna Tablet PC menulis kata "Fred" dalam kotak teks, akan dikenali sebagai dan dikonversi ke kata "merah".
Untuk membuat daftar frasa input lingkup:
-
Klik kustom dalam kotak dialog Input lingkup , dan lalu klik baru.
-
Dalam kotak nama , ketikkan nama frasa daftar lingkup input pengaturan.
-
Di daftar tipe , klik Daftar frasa.
-
Untuk setiap kata atau frasa dalam daftar, ketik kata atau frasa dalam kotak frasa , dan lalu klik Tambahkan.
Setelah Daftar frasa telah dibuat di Templat formulir, Anda bisa menerapkan ini ke kontrol lainnya pada formulir dengan memilih dari daftar lingkup Input .
Catatan: Jika Anda menghapus frasa daftar lingkup input yang telah diterapkan ke kontrol, lingkup input akan juga dihapus dari semua kontrol lain yang telah diterapkan, dan definisi akan dihapus dari Templat formulir.
Ekspresi reguler
Mengatur lingkup input ekspresi reguler memungkinkan Anda menentukan ekspresi reguler yang menentukan pola kustom untuk membatasi atau biasing input yang dimasukkan ke kontrol. Anda bisa mempelajari selengkapnya tentang sintaks ekspresi reguler yang digunakan oleh Microsoft Office InfoPath 2007 input lingkup di Microsoft Tablet PC Software Development Kit (SDK).
Untuk membuat ekspresi reguler input lingkup pengaturan:
-
Klik kustom dalam kotak dialog Input lingkup , dan lalu klik baru.
-
Dalam kotak nama , ketikkan nama ekspresi reguler lingkup input pengaturan.
-
Di daftar tipe , klik Ekspresi reguler.
-
Dalam kotak Ekspresi reguler , ketikkan rumus ekspresi reguler.
Setelah ekspresi reguler yang telah dibuat di Templat formulir, Anda bisa menerapkan ini ke kontrol lainnya pada formulir dengan memilih dari daftar lingkup Input .
Catatan: Jika Anda menghapus lingkup input ekspresi reguler yang telah diterapkan ke kontrol, lingkup input akan dihapus dari semua kontrol lain yang telah diterapkan, dan definisi akan dihapus dari Templat formulir.
Tabel berikut ini memperlihatkan beberapa contoh ekspresi reguler yang bisa digunakan untuk membuat pengaturan lingkup input kustom.
Ekspresi |
Deskripsi |
Kecocokan |
Non-kecocokan |
(0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) |
Mencocokkan setiap digit tunggal, 1 sampai 9. |
1 6 0 |
42 salah |
(0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 |, |-) + |
Cocok dengan satu atau beberapa satu digit, koma, atau garis putus-putus. Berguna untuk membatasi input ke rentang atau serangkaian angka, seperti rentang halaman untuk mencetak. |
1 1-6 2,4,7 2 - 6,9,135,,, |
Tiga 7 melalui 9 |
(0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) (0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) (0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9)-(0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) (0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9)-(0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) (0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) (0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) (0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) (0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) |
Nomor jaminan sosial. Format nomor jaminan sosial adalah nnn-nn-nnnn. |
123 45 6789 |
12-123-12 12-2-3456 |
(0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) (0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) (0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| -(A| 9) B | C | D | E | F | G | H | Saya | J | K | L | M | N | O | P | TANYA | R | T | U | V | W | X | Y | Z)(A| B | C | D | E | F | G | H | Saya | J | K | L | M | N | O | P | TANYA | R | T | U | V | W | X | Y | Z)(A| B | C | D | E | F | G | H | Saya | J | K | L | M | N | O | P | TANYA | R | T | U | V | W | X | Y | Z)-(0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) (0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) (0 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9) |
Bagian jumlah format ini: ### AAA ### mana # setiap digit tunggal dari 0 sampai 9, dan adalah huruf besar semua tunggal dari A ke Z. |
123 ABC 456 |
12 AB 3456 123 456 789 |
s(!IS_ONECHAR) + p |
Cocok dengan kata apa pun yang dimulai dengan huruf "s", berisi satu atau beberapa karakter (seperti yang ditentukan oleh cakupan input IS_ONECHAR), dan diakhiri dengan huruf "p". |
berhenti sup schlep s234p |
Berhenti sp |